How Portsmouth’s seasons affect garage doors

Portsmouth’s freeze-thaw cycles widen gaps in garage door seals, letting in cold drafts that freeze tracks in winter. Salt from winter road treatments corrodes hinges near the Portsmouth Traffic Circle, while summer humidity causes wood doors to warp near the waterfront. We recommend seasonal checks—especially before January’s nor’easters and August’s heat waves—to catch issues early. Our Portsmouth clients see fewer breakdowns when they schedule spring track cleaning and fall hinge lubrication. Learn seasonal tips. We use marine-grade grease on coastal homes to fight rust.

Portsmouth garage door replacement: brick vs. modern materials

Portsmouth homeowners often debate replacing old wood garage doors with modern steel or fiberglass. Steel doors resist salt air better near the Memorial Bridge, while fiberglass mimics historic carriage-house styles in the South End. We help weigh pros and cons: steel dents, fiberglass fades, and wood rots without maintenance. For brick garages, we recommend insulated steel doors to cut heating costs in Portsmouth’s drafty older homes. Compare options. We source doors locally to avoid long lead times.

Portsmouth, NH garage door repair: typical costs and frequency
ServiceTypical Cost in PortsmouthFrequency for Older Homes
Track alignment & hinge replacement$220–$450Every 3–5 years
Spring & cable replacement$180–$350Every 7–10 years
Opener repair/replacement$250–$600Every 10–15 years
Weatherstripping & seal replacement$50–$120Every 2–4 years
Masonry anchor reinforcement$150–$300As needed
